Transaction 743f53fa5f7c75457118b0af371ad32bf30c4ecbc5a513e45b3ad77115af7191
2 Input
2 Outputs
- 743f53fa5f7c75457118b0af371ad32bf30c4ecbc5a513e45b3ad77115af7191:0
- 743f53fa5f7c75457118b0af371ad32bf30c4ecbc5a513e45b3ad77115af7191:1
value 3525245
address 193QEqsV6fpBqczJgNgU4YMwEtWmeeTMsj
value 20638017
address 3PouvzxrtL1Vc1vttE7HCNMFiqZJTnWwBP